Output dedca5e57160513e7e7a3ec6064329024fa585478a1a33d8824a3e1b17430f5e:0

value
5188600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b587d53a38f66d7e0d1ce410303d8ea0b1d25bf OP_EQUAL
address
3EPora3ABRGukj2uMkJg4MVksxhwVqy87H
transaction
dedca5e57160513e7e7a3ec6064329024fa585478a1a33d8824a3e1b17430f5e
spent
true